The Critical Role of CoverMyMeds in Cardiology ePA Workflows

CoverMyMeds serves as a primary electronic prior authorization (ePA) channel for medications across the healthcare landscape. In cardiology, where specialty drugs often carry high costs and complex utilization management criteria, efficient integration with CoverMyMeds is crucial for ensuring timely access to life-sustaining treatments. Klivira leverages this channel to automate the submission and tracking of cardiology medication PAs.

High-Volume Cardiology Medications Requiring ePA via CoverMyMeds

  • PCSK9 inhibitors (e.g., for severe hypercholesterolemia)
  • Sacubitril/valsartan (Entresto) for heart failure with reduced ejection fraction (HFrEF)
  • SGLT2 inhibitors when indicated for heart failure
  • Mavacamten for hypertrophic cardiomyopathy
  • Select novel oral anticoagulants in specific populations

Key Documentation for Cardiology Drug PAs Submitted via CoverMyMeds

  • For PCSK9 inhibitors: Documentation of LDL on maximum tolerated statin therapy plus ezetimibe trial.
  • For sacubitril/valsartan: HFrEF documentation, including ejection fraction.
  • For SGLT2 inhibitors for HF: Ejection fraction or documented heart failure with preserved ejection fraction (HFpEF) criteria.
  • For mavacamten: Symptom severity and specific diagnostic criteria for hypertrophic cardiomyopathy.
